Toward a Genuine Economic and Monetary Union

This workshop’s purpose is to inspire reflection on the long-term future of Economic and Monetary Union (EMU). Starting from current crisis-related challenges, the workshop focuses on four areas in which reforms might increase the resilience of EMU architecture and the prosperity of the euro area. The workshop intends to give an overview of the current state of economic research and the policy debate, with an emphasis on creative proposals aimed at overcoming existing deadlocks. The specific areas covered are in line with the recent “Five Presidents’ Report – Completing Europe's Economic and Monetary Union”: Economic, Financial, Fiscal and Political Union.
